Ranking of Idaho Counties By Population with Cajun Ancestry in 2021

Updated on April 16,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, there were 200 people in Idaho with Cajun ancestry. Among all Idaho counties, Ada County had the highest population with Cajun ancestry (90), followed by Canyon County (53), and Idaho County (23).
